Job Overview:
We are seeking a detail-oriented and experienced Billing and Coding Auditor to join our team.
As a Billing and Coding Auditor, you will be responsible for coordinating surveys/audits including tracking deliverables, tasks, and corrective actions to ensure accuracy and compliance with industry regulations.
This is a vital role in maintaining the integrity of our organizationResponsibilities:
- Manages ongoing auditing and monitoring in accordance with the established Annual Audit Work Plan and relevant policies and procedures, including coordination of physician prebilling reviews and followup on corrective actions identified. Ensures timely execution of compliance program elements and maintenance of established compliance metrics.
- Assists in the development of appropriate policies and educational documents related to compliance with documentation and coding requirements.
- Develops and implements processes that will effectively monitor/track compliance requirements, including reports, performance metrics and scorecards for the Billing/ Coding Audit team.
- Provides education on coding and documentation requirements as part of New Hire Orientation for staff, oneonone sessions for newly hired clinicians, and inservices on regulatory changes as appropriate and timely.
- Manages weekly quality reporting notifications (MIPS) for practice clinical operations.
- Performs other jobrelated duties as required.
